Not sure what the situation is now, but for some time Encore East (340) in HD an SD was only available to Starz subscribers. Encore West (341) and the rest of the Encore themed movie channels (372-347) were available as part of AT250 and higher. Those with lesser packages could also get 341-347 as part of the Encore Movie Pack for $6.

I am not sure if there is any substantive change to the package other than the name of the package. Perhaps Encore East will now be part of "Encore Movies." I don't know.
